Shared Ownership
The scheme allows you to purchase the specified share of the property price and pay a reduced rent on the share you do not own. You will have the opportunity to buy further shares (subject to affordability) at a later date. As a shared owner you will be an assured tenant until you own 100% of the shares for the property, after which you will own the leasehold interest

Eligibility
• You must be at least 18 years old
• You should live or work in the borough of Oxford
• Outside of London your annual household income must be less than £80,000
• You cannot own another home. Shared Ownership purchasers are often first-time buyers but if you do already own another property (either in the UK or abroad), you must be in the process of selling it
• You should not be able to afford to buy a home suitable for your housing needs on the open market.
• You must show you are not in mortgage or rent arrears
• You must be able to demonstrate that you have a good credit history (no bad debts or County Court Judgements) and can afford the regular payments and costs involved in buying a home.
• You must be earning a household income of at least £49,409 per annum, with a minimum deposit of £8,125
